The Academic Operations Manager serves as the primary projectmanager for the college’s academic cycle, ensuring the structuralintegrity of undergraduate and graduate curricula through thetechnical management of CourseDog and PeopleSoft. Reporting to theDirector of Academic Operations and Student Services, this rolebridges high-level strategy and operational reality by leveragingenrollment analytics for capacity planning and developingstreamlined workflows using integrated digital platforms such asAsana. From synchronizing instructional logistics and facultyassignments to serving as the final gatekeeper for data accuracy,the operations manager ensures a seamless, reliable registrationexperience that meets all institutional deadlines.

The University of Minnesota, Twin Cities (UMTC), is among thelargest public research universities in the country, offeringundergraduate, graduate, and professional students a multitude ofopportunities for study and research. Located at the heart of oneof the nation's most vibrant, diverse metropolitan communities,students on the campuses in Minneapolis and St. Paul benefit fromextensive partnerships with world-renowned health centers,international corporations, government agencies, and arts,nonprofit, and public service organizations.
